Transaction 135401118039953cf42f7049a65108e07095a873d0ec0226324cdb7c55ac2066
1 Input
1 Output
-
135401118039953cf42f7049a65108e07095a873d0ec0226324cdb7c55ac2066:0
- value
- 266284
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 acc89817aeb25b73325b326249e0989ab89f29abebff770a6c21c70ccd610572
- address
- bc1p4nyfs9awkfdhxvjmxf3yncycn2uf72dta0lhwznvy8rsentpq4eqy4z383